core/pom.xml
<https://reviews.apache.org/r/26678/#comment98744>

    Can we move the concrete implementation to it's own module? I would prefer 
not to introduce hadoop dependency on core.



core/src/main/java/org/apache/sqoop/authentication/AuthenticationHandlerFactory.java
<https://reviews.apache.org/r/26678/#comment98745>

    If the type is neither of "KERBEROS" nor "SIMPLE" can we try to use it as a 
classname and instantiate it?
    
    I would like to provide user ability to specify their own authentication 
class implementation if needed. This one can be probably done in follow up JIRA 
though :)



core/src/main/java/org/apache/sqoop/authentication/KerberosAuthenticationHandler.java
<https://reviews.apache.org/r/26678/#comment98746>

    I would thrown an exception if the property 
AuthenticationConstants.AUTHENTICATION_KERBEROS_KEYTAB  is not defined rather 
then trying some default location of the keytab - it majority of cases the 
default value won't be correct.



core/src/main/java/org/apache/sqoop/authentication/KerberosAuthenticationHandler.java
<https://reviews.apache.org/r/26678/#comment98747>

    I would thrown an exception if the property 
AuthenticationConstants.AUTHENTICATION_KERBEROS_PRINCIPAL is not defined rather 
then trying some default value as in majority of cases the default value won't 
be correct.
